Respondent shall revise any workplan, report, <br />specification, or schedule in accordance with DTSC's <br />written comments. Respondent shall submit to DTSC any <br />revised documents by the due date specified by DTSC. <br />Revised submittals are subject to DTSC's approval or <br />disapproval. <br />7.2. Upon receipt of DTSC's written approval, <br />Respondent shall commence work and implement any approved <br />workplan in accordance with the schedule and provisions <br />contained therein. <br />7.3. Any DTSC approved workplan, report, <br />specification, <br />°bschedule <br />incorporateddintothis <br />thisoConsent <br />Agreement shall be <br />Agreement. <br />7.4. Verbal advice, suggestions, or comments given by <br />DTSC representatives will not constitute an official - <br />approval or decision. <br />SUBMITTALS <br />8.1. Beginning with the first full month following the <br />effective date of this Consent Agreement, Respondent shall <br />provide DTSC with quarterly progress reports of corrective <br />action activities conducted pursuant to this Consent <br />Agreement. Progress reports are due on the first day of <br />the month when reports are due. The progress reports shall <br />conform to the. Scope of Work for Progress Reports contained <br />in Attachment 1. DTSC may adjust the frequency of progress <br />reporting to be consistent with site-specific activities. <br />8.2. Any report or other document submitted by <br />Respondent pursuant to this Consent Agreement shall be <br />signed and certified by the project coordinator, a <br />responsible corporate officer, or a duly authorized <br />representative. <br />8.3.
